Understanding the Science Behind Stress
Stress impacts us in myriad ways, both physically and emotionally. It’s our body’s natural response to perceived threats, and while a little stress can be motivating, chronic stress wreaks havoc on our well-being. When we’re stressed, our body produces cortisol, often referred to as the “stress hormone.” This surge can lead to an increase in oil production, which, when mixed with dead skin cells, can result in clogged pores and—surprise—breakouts.
The Hormonal Rollercoaster
For many women, hormonal fluctuations add another layer of complexity to skin health. Whether it’s the hormonal changes during your menstrual cycle or the additional hormonal adjustments we face as we age, these shifts can exacerbate skin flare-ups. Understanding this interplay helped me realize that my skin’s response during stressful times was more than just a random occurrence. It was a biological reaction, intertwined with what was happening emotionally and physically in my life.
